Precautions??? I changed tranny fluids to B&M Trick Shift for auto trannies.....also installed a B&M tranny cooler as well. Feels fine....no slips. Then again, I do not really beat on it a whole lot. I am running 8 PSI daily too. I am pushing about 147 WHP & 124 WTQ consistantly without tranny downshifts....I also have a fully functionally cat too. It's like having the pick up of a small V6 in a 4cyl car..........

whenever i want to redline every gear i start in D3 and i floor it so it stays/shifts to 1st. then when it shifts to second i put in in 2 since its already in 2nd gear it will stay there until you shift it back to D3 where it will shift to 3rd. D3 will keep it in 3rd gear until you move to D
